Ir para conteúdo
  • Cadastre-se

wilson_jr

Membros
  • Total de ítens

    152
  • Registro em

  • Última visita

Tudo que wilson_jr postou

  1. Bom dia Edson, Obrigado pela resposta, mas isso já faço, o meu problema é que os clientes precisam imprimir as notas com o percentual de desconto idêntico ao informado no pedido, como citei acima se vender um item a 19.9 com 35% de desconto na danfe sai 34.97%, e isso causa problemas quando são notas para o governo ou de licitações.... Att, Wilson.
  2. Bom dia Henrique, Faz tempo que busco outra solução... mas obrigado pela sua atenção.
  3. Boa tarde Henrique, Este campo seria apenas para gerar o DANFE com o percentual de desconto fixo. Não é enviado para o XML. Att, Wilson
  4. Bom dia Juliomar, Mesmo utilizando o ABNT, não dará o resultado que preciso, no caso anexo tenho um item de 19.9 com desconto de 35%, se deixar calcular o desconto ficará em 34.97%. Alterei as units como de costume, caso aceitem implementar no ACBr ficarei grato. Att, Wilson. Fixo.pdf Calculado.pdf pcnNFe.pas ACBrNFeDANFeRL.pas ACBrNFeDANFeRLPaisagem.pas ACBrNFeDANFeRLRetrato.pas ACBrNFeDANFeRLSimplificado.pas ACBrNFeDANFEFRDM.pas
  5. Boa tarde! Mesmo assim não preenche como o demonstrado no primeiro post. Tentei gravar também o ACBrNFe.NotasFiscais[0].XMLAssinado, mas nenhum vem com a infProt preenchida. As suas notas ficam com o <infProt Id= "" ?> Grato.
  6. bom dia Régys, só utilizo o enviar(nro_lote,false), nisso o xml é salvo sem esse preenchimento. Saberia o pq? Grato.
  7. wilson_jr

    Duvida: tag infProt.

    Boa tarde, a Amazon está rejeitando as notas em que a tag infProt esteja vazia. Ao gerar as minhas notas está ficando assim: <protNFe versao="3.10"> <infProt> <tpAmb>2</tpAmb> <verAplic>SP_NFE_PL_008h2</verAplic> <chNFe>35160204528398000194550000000107351014224925</chNFe> <dhRecbto>2016-02-16T12:11:29-02:00</dhRecbto> <nProt>135160000552158</nProt> <digVal>LxruHy0Wk/nuw/aH4qoGDsW9vNs=</digVal> <cStat>100</cStat> <xMotivo>Autorizado o uso da NF-e</xMotivo> </infProt> </protNFe> Porém quando baixo o xml da sefaz fica preenchida a tag: <protNFe versao="3.10"> <infProt Id="Id135160000552158"> <tpAmb>2</tpAmb> <verAplic>SP_NFE_PL_008h2</verAplic> <chNFe>35160204528398000194550000000107351014224925</chNFe> <dhRecbto>2016-02-16T12:11:29-02:00</dhRecbto> <nProt>135160000552158</nProt> <digVal>LxruHy0Wk/nuw/aH4qoGDsW9vNs=</digVal> <cStat>100</cStat> <xMotivo>Autorizado o uso da NF-e</xMotivo> </infProt> </protNFe> Alguém saberia me informar como preencho essa tag? Grato, Wilson.
  8. Prezados bom dia! Dei uma pesquisada, mas não encontrei nada do gênero. Temos como principal categoria de clientes livrarias e editoras, elas trabalham normalmente dando desconto em suas notas, principalmente quando há consignação de produtos. O que ocorre: ao fazer o pedido será dado 35% de desconto, mas nem sempre o valor do desconto no Danfe sai os 35%, as vezes sai 34,99%, 34,98%, 35,01%, isso devido que passamos o valor do item e valor do desconto e esse percentual é recalculado no momento da impressão do Danfe. Isso não está errado já que se der por exemplo os 34,99% dará o valor liquido correto. Já tentei falar para eles utilizarem o desconto em R$, mas nenhum aceita, pois normalmente os contratos e licitações constam que os itens tem que ir com x% de desconto e eles querem imprimir com esse desconto exato. Muitos "clientes dos nossos clientes" rejeitam as notas por essa questão, principalmente quando é para o governo, se não sair exatamente como definido a nota volta. Desde o trunk já havia criado um campo novo para informar esse desconto sem que seja recalculado, foi a única forma que encontrei. Só que qualquer alteração no ACBr gera retrabalho a cada atualização, pois tenho que refazer a instalação e refazer as mudanças no componente... O que fiz foi criar um novo campo vDescFixo, e se há valor nele mando ele para o Danfe e não calculo o %. Sei que isso não é algo que atrapalhe os demais, mas sempre perco tempo refazendo isso. Gostaria de verificar se alguém tem alguma ideia melhor do que mexer no código a cada atualização, ou se posso postar as alterações para analisarem se anexam ao ACBr. Ah, ao ler o xml para a reimpressão o percentual é recalculado pois o componente não tem esse campo para se basear, mas isso eu contornei pelo meu aplicativo. Att, Wilson
  9. Prezados, bom dia! Resolveu colocando as colunas com 48 como sugeriu o Daniel. Muito obrigado! Att, Wilson
  10. é essa mesmo, na verdade isso ocorre no cliente, estou sem impressora aqui para testar.
  11. Bom dia, Estou mudando de Fortes para ESCPOS, e ao reimprimir um cupom ele saiu sem valores, sabem o que pode ser? Att, Wilson
  12. Clerison, Bom dia! Aqui está normal, estou utilizando o Trunk2 sem problemas. Só lembrando que ao migrar, haverá necessidade de alterações em seu código, pois algumas funções e propriedades sofreram alterações.
  13. Boa tarde! Por acaso há outra maneira para pegar o xml sem ser pela consulta de sessão? Pois a linha do meu cancelamento ficou assim: 08:55:01:827 - NumeroSessao: 516343 - Resposta:Erro|Erro na leitura da porta de comunicacao com o S@T|Header porém mesmo com esse retorno o cupom foi cancelado no sat e posteriormente na sefaz. e se consultar por esse numero de sessão fala que não existe. ah, extraindo o log do SAT tb não acho a sessão. Pelo site não tem a opção de download igual a nfe. Grato.
  14. Boa tarde! Descobri, é o nosso antivírus (Trend Micro), estranho é que só em duas maquinas isso ocorre. Mas blz, vlw. Abraços.
  15. Bom dia! Ainda continua lento, desinstalei os drivers, instalei os mais recentes. Rodei como administrador. Nada ainda, mas não estou muito preocupado com isso pq isso acontece somente nas maquinas de desenvolvimento aqui, as que o nosso suporte usam está normal. Normalmente é o contrário, as maquinas de clientes que não funcionam e a nossa que desenvolve vai de boa. Bom, assim que der vou tentar ver se consigo debugar onde realmente fica lento e posto aqui, mas pelo visto só eu estou com isso. Abraços.
  16. Boa tarde! Mesmo setando o ACBr conforme abaixo, ainda está salvando os arquivos "auxiliares". ACBrNFe1.Configuracoes.Geral.Salvar := False; ACBrNFe1.Configuracoes.Arquivos.Salvar := True; Verifiquei no código da imagem em anexo que esses arquivos estão utilizando a Arquivos.Salvar e não a Geral.Salvar. Seria isso mesmo? Att, Wilson.
  17. Bom dia! Utilizo o capicom, e já atualizei com as novas dlls mencionadas. O que parece é que ele demora para carregar. Inclui o código abaixo que não tinha visto antes, mas não mudou: {$IFDEF ACBrNFeOpenSSL} ACBrNFe1.Configuracoes.Geral.SSLLib := libOpenSSL; {$else} ACBrNFe1.Configuracoes.Geral.SSLLib := libCapicom; {$endif} Coloquei esse código para verificar e na primeira vez que passa pela linha do Carregar Certificado demora, na segunda vez que passa é rápido. ACBrNFe1.Configuracoes.Certificados.NumeroSerie:= edtNumSerie.Text; if ACBrNFe1.SSL.CertificadoLido = False then ACBrNFe1.SSL.CarregarCertificado; lblValidade.Caption := DateToStr(ACBrNFe1.SSL.CertDataVenc); Sabem se tem mais alguma coisa que posso verificar?
  18. Boa tarde Alexandre! você está considerando que 0 é cancelado com sucesso, mas aparentemente no ACBr só irá salvar o xml se o retorno for 7000. você está fazendo mais algum tratamento quanto a isso? Att, Wilson.
  19. Boa tarde! Teria algum motivo ao utilizar essa função ela demorar para retornar a data? Aqui para mim está bem lento quando passa pela linha que me mostra a validade. lblDataCert.Caption := 'Certificado Válido Até:' + DateToStr(FConfNFe.ACBrNFe1.SSL.CertDataVenc); Att, Wilson.
  20. Obrigado pelo retorno! Estava achando estranho a parte do cancelamento, mas atualizei o fonte novamente e agora apareceu essa implementação do retorno 7000. Vlw.
  21. Bom dia jrs.santos! Olhando o fonte não achei onde ao consultar a sessão está salvando o xml do cancelamento. Como ficou a sua rotina para isso? Grato!
  22. Bom dia! há as duas formas, também estou utilizando ACBrSAT1.CancelarUltimaVenda; Quando utilizo o emulador o retorno que recebo é 7000 e no sat da bematech retorna 0, mas cancela. Ainda não descobri o que é.
  23. Boa Tarde! Fiz uma venda e em seguida fui cancelar, na minha aplicação recebi o código de retorno: 0. Tentei cancelar novamente, mas começou a dar erro 7099. Olhando o log do sat bematech: 20150820142753|AC-SAT|info|Recebendo dados de cancelamento 20150820142753|AC-SAT|info|Dados de cancelamento recebidos com sucesso 20150820142753|AC-SAT|info|Mecanismo de segurança de emissão criado com sucesso 20150820142753|SAT-AC|info|Cupom cancelado com sucesso 20150820142951|AC-SAT|info|Recebendo dados de cancelamento 20150820142951|AC-SAT|info|Dados de cancelamento recebidos com sucesso 20150820142952|AC-SAT|erro|Tentativa de cancelar um CFe já cancelado 20150820142952|SAT-AC|erro|Erro ao cancelar o cupom fiscal Uma duvida, como vou saber se o cupom já foi cancelado? pois consultando a chave no site, consta como processada. Como é que o SAT informa que o cupom foi cancelado, pois no log vi a comunicação da venda, mas não aparece a comunicação do cancelamento. Sei que o código que deveria receber era 1218 de cupom já cancelado, mas parece que o sat ainda não informou a sefaz do cancelamento. Grato.
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...